International was ahead of their time with the introduction of the crew cab pickup truck in the mid 1950's with their 3 door pickup. In 1961 International came out with the first ever 4 door "Crew Cab" pickup available to the market and was decades ahead of the big three on producing a full production in house crew cab pickup. Unfortunately in the 1960's crew cab trucks were hard to sell to the public and most were sold to the railroad companies and government contracts. Fast forward to todays market and four door pickup trucks are now the most popular! So todays buyer looking for a "crew cab" classic truck has very few options! Resulting in the demand and the short supply of these clean example trucks has created large value increases and very hot demand!

The former Oklahoma owner purchased the truck in 2010 from its long term second owner, the third owner began transforming it. First, he converted it to four-wheel drive with locking hubs using all correct International parts. Next, he professionally converted the power plant to a Cummins 12-valve, 5.7L inline turbodiesel six-cylinder engine that was casted by International with 90K miles during time of the swap. He converted the braking system to a “Hydroboost” with front disc brakes and installed a rebuilt Getrag five speed transmission. The previous owner stated that the truck achieves around 21 MPG on the highway with the Cummins conversion.

The bodywork is straight and solid, the engine bay is tidy and the cargo bed looks great with the Cummins swap. In addition, the bed has its own liner along with a lockable storage/fuel tank at the forward end that holds 32 gallons of diesel, beneath the rear window. The truck rides on Falken Rocky Mountain tires, size LT315/75R16 at all four corners, mounted on 10" wide Wheelsmith Custom wheels with correct International wheel covers. The truck has a 2.5" body lift to stance the larger tires perfectly.

A 90K mile Cummins B-series, 12-valve, 360 CID inline six-cylinder turbodiesel replaced the original V-8 motor. One of the owner’s buddies fabricated a custom crossmember and mounts for the engine and transmission, which was swapped in a rebuilt Getrag five-speed manual transmission for the factory four-speed manual. International cast the engine’s block and head for Cummins. Driver convenience features include power steering and hydroboost power brakes. There is a complete air-conditioning system included with compressor and the very hard to find Cummins AC bracket and a genuine International under dash unit but the system is currently not installed.

The previous owner revamped the truck’s interior, installing a front seat from a 1969 International-Harvester with a back seat from a 2000 Dodge pickup. The seats, with their red cushions with white trim, look great and will haul six people in a pinch. The black carpet is in great shape while the headliner above is in great condition. A four-spoke Italian steering wheel is present, the red metal instrument panel features VDO gauges with a digital odometer. The dash and inner door panels are all in very good order. Completing the interior is a retro AM/FM radio with iPod/iphone connectivity.
